Brake is a national road safety charity that cares for road victims and campaigns for safer roads for all. Brake's National Road Victim Service is a specialist support service to help families cope with the shock, turmoil and devastation that road crashes cause families across the UK every day.

Brake is a really worthwhile cause that needs more support to help spread the road safety message to both young and old. Every day, there are nine deaths and 82 serious injuries on UK roads. Brake’s mission, and my wish, is to save others from the unnecessary pain of losing someone in a road accident, as well as to help care for those affected by one.
